The Wareham Gatemen (1-0) jumped out to an early lead on the Falmouth Commodores (0-1) and captured a 7-1 victory on Thursday at Spillane Field.
Five runs in the first three innings allowed the Wareham Gatemen to put the game away early.
An RBI single by Tyler Horan in the first inning fueled the Wareham Gatemen's offense early.Horan went a perfect 3-3 at the dish for the Wareham Gatemen.
Nicholas Rumbelow brought the heat against the Falmouth Commodores during his outing. Rumbelow held the Falmouth Commodores hitless over 1 1/3 innings, allowed no earned runs, walked none and struck out four.
Kendall Graveman got the win, running his season record to 1-0. He allowed one run over 6 2/3 innings. Graveman struck out one, walked two and gave up eight hits.
Trey Masek was charged with his first loss of the year. He allowed seven runs in six innings, walked four and struck out six.
